We are seeking a dedicated and experienced Senior Carer to join our team in a full-time role (40 hours per week). The Senior Carer will be responsible for delivering high-quality care, performing administrative duties, managing medication orders, maintaining care plans, and conducting quality checks to support CQC regulatory compliance, as designated by the Nursing Team.

The successful candidate will play a vital role in promoting independence, safety, and well-being for our clients across a variety of care settings. This paid position offers an opportunity to make a meaningful difference in people's lives while developing valuable skills within the healthcare sector.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ide compassionate and effective care to service users, ensuring both physical and emotional needs are met.
  • Assist with personal care tasks, including bathing, dressing, and mobility support.
  • Administer medication in accordance with care plans and regulatory standards.
  • Order and manage medication supplies, ensuring timely and accurate processing and routine delivery.
  • Maintain accurate records of administration tasks for regulatory audit purposes.
  • Perform designated administrative tasks such as handling enquiries, scheduling/rostering, filing, and communication with families and professionals.
  • Conduct quality checks and audits as assigned to ensure compliance with care standards.
  • Support junior staff and provide guidance during onboarding as needed.
  • Report concerns and incidents promptly and accurately to the RGN and BM.
Working Hours

Working 5 days out of 7 days each week.

Supervision

The Senior Carer will report directly to the Registered General Nurse (RGN) and Registered Manager. Regular training, supervision, and performance reviews will be conducted to ensure high standards of care and professional development.

Person Specification
  • Qualifications: NVQ Level 3 in Health and Social Care or equivalent.
  • Experience: Minimum of 3 years experience in a care setting, preferably in a senior role.
  • Strong communication, administrative and organisational skills.
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
  • Knowledge of medication management, clinical care skills and care planning.
  • Must be able to drive as part of this role.

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
